  • IPad auto deleting browser history in safari

    My partners iPad(1) 16GB WiFi (Firmware 4.3.3) is deleting all browser history sparadically. For example it was there for 1 week and then deleted for 2 days running. Is this a reported fault or are they just manually clearing the history to hide stuff?

    Ok...maybe preferences are corrupted...
    Go to ~/Library/Prerferences
    Move the com.apple.Safari.plist file from the Preferences folder to the Desktop.
    Quit then relaunch Safari, go to the menu bar click History > Clear History
    If that helped, move the .plist file from the Preferences folder to the Trash. If not, just move it back to the Preferences folder.
    If you don't want history saved when you visit Facebook, go to the Safari menu bar click Safari > Private Browsing

    The problem is that a lot of these programs actually don't get the proper ratings. This is a bug. For instance:
    Take a look at the app for OpenTable.  It's rated 4+.  But if you go into the app and click "About" in the menu, then go to "help and Support," it pops you into an embedded web browser that is directed to the Opentable website.  With a little bit of work, you can get the browser to navigate to Google or somewhere else that will give you carte blanche to see any site, including ****. I have watched this happen with family members, and it reveals a serious defect in the parental controls portion of the iOS ratings system.
    Here's how to fix If a browser is embedded in an app, even for reading local HTML, the app gets a 17+.  The only ways to avoid the 17+ rating are: (1) use Safari to open HTML pages/links (which honors parental control settings); or (2) restrict all browser activity to either local files or a very select set of remote web pages on a trusted site.

  • How to recover deleted browser history using time machine on osx lion

    I turned my time machine backup on. Deleted some of my browser history. And restored the entire App, Google chrome, hoping my history would reappear. However it didn't. Same with Safari.
    What am I missing? Or rather, how to restore just the hisotry and not the rest of the application?

    I'm surprised because I just opened History.plist in TextWrangler and all the history listings are in there. There may be some interaction with other parts of what Safari saves during a session, and the only other approach that comes to mind is more serious surgery. The History.plist you found is contained in a folder called "Safari" along with a bunch of other stuff. At the risk of losing anything else you've done in Safari since then (e.g., new bookmarks), try restoring the entire Safari folder from Time Machine, being sure that the TM point you've selected is before the deletion. You might want to copy the current Safari folder to the Desktop first, just in case. And, again, Safari must not be running during the attempt.
    There is also a Safari directory in /Users/username/Library/Caches/Metadata/Safari which has a history component in it but I'm not sure if you need that restored, too.
